Title: Innovations by Kathleen Elizabeth Morse
Introduction
Kathleen Elizabeth Morse is a notable inventor based in Painted Post, NY (US). She has made significant contributions to the field of glass manufacturing, holding a total of four patents. Her work focuses on improving the quality of glass sheets by minimizing inclusions during the production process.
Latest Patents
Kathleen's latest patents include a method and apparatus for minimizing inclusions in a glass-making process. The first patent describes a method for forming a glass sheet with reduced inclusions, which involves flowing molten glass over converging forming surfaces of a forming body positioned within an enclosure. This method utilizes a plurality of heating elements that are separated from the forming body by an inner wall of the enclosure. The temperature at the bottom of the forming body is decoupled from the temperature at the top by an insulating thermal barrier, ensuring that changes in temperature do not cause substantial fluctuations in the overall process.
The second patent outlines an apparatus designed to form a glass sheet with reduced zircon inclusions. This apparatus features heating elements distributed vertically between the weirs of a forming wedge and the root of the forming wedge, with a thermal barrier placed between adjacent heating elements. A method of using this apparatus is also disclosed, further enhancing the efficiency of glass production.
Career Highlights
Kathleen works at Corning Incorporated, a leading company in glass and ceramics technology. Her innovative approaches have contributed to advancements in the industry, showcasing her expertise and dedication to improving glass manufacturing processes.
Collaborations
Kathleen has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Andrey V Filippov and Bulent Kocatulum. These partnerships have fostered a collaborative environment that encourages innovation and the sharing of ideas.
